What is the A1 exam?

The Goethe-Zertifikat A1: Start Deutsch 1 is a German language exam for adults. It is a basic-level test that tests your ability to understand and communicate in everyday scenarios. It is the first level of the Common European Framework of Reference for Languages.

The test is comprised of four parts that include reading, listening, writing and speaking. In the reading part you will be asked to read and understand szkoła nauki jazdy a1 small messages, signs, and labels. In the writing section you will be required to fill out forms and write a short letter or email about everyday subjects. You will be asked to speak about yourself, your job and the location where you reside. You will also be asked basic questions. In the listening part, you will be asked to listen to audio recordings of everyday conversations announcements, messages from the telephone and przepisy Kategorii a1 respond to questions from the audio you hear.

What is the format of the A1 exam?

The A1 exam is a standardized language test that assesses the fundamental skills required when communicating in German. The test is designed to help non-native speakers prove their proficiency in German. It is an excellent way to begin the journey to fluency and is often required for certain visa applications. Whether you are looking to study, work or travel in Germany Passing this test is a huge step towards your goal.

The Goethe-Zertifikat A1: Start Deutsch 1 exam comprises listening, reading, and speaking sections. The test is conducted in the same manner around the globe. You will be asked to read short notes, classified advertisements, descriptions of people, and simple newspaper text in the reading section. You will then complete tasks based on these. You will also listen to short everyday conversations, private telephone messages and public announcements over the loudspeaker. You will complete tasks based on what you have heard.

You will be asked to write a letter or a reply to an email. You will also write short pieces on a common topic and complete tasks that are based on these. Then, you'll write an entire sentence in German and answer questions about the contents you wrote. The oral portion of the A1 test is conducted in groups of 3-4 people. The examiner will ask questions that require a yes or no answer, and may also request specific information. This section will require you to talk for about 20 minutes.
